It is not that the news of the possibility of linking Noida by Metro in its network appeared for the first time in media. But it is the first time that it is the top news in the national daily and it has come from a man of the reputation of E Sreedharan who has earned his reputation for completing projects of global quality standard ahead of the schedule time almost always. He deserves to be called the best project manager of the country.

On November 19, 2005, The Time of India reported E Sreedharan, managing director, Delhi Metro Rail Corporation saying, “Metro link to Noida will be included in Phase II and completed by 2010. The exact alignment for Noida has been worked out. For connecting Noida, the Metro will extend its line that touches the Commonwealth Games village by another 7 km. with 6 stations in Sector 15,16,Noida Botanical garden, Golf Course and Noida Sector 32 City Centre along the route.
